This paper examined the association between unethical leadership and workers’ unethical behaviour in the hospitality industry in Nigeria. The geographical/survey scope of the study covers the South-South region. The sample frame and units of analysis consist of 274 chefs, potters, housekeepers, waiters and waitresses drawn from 187 hotels operating in the region. Profitability Analysis Of Tabasco Chillies Grown By Smallholder Farmers In Nyanga District, Manicaland Province, Zimbabwe
This study analysed the profitability of tabasco chillies production in Nyanga and soci-economic factors impacting on profitability. The study used data collected from a sample of 119 smallholder farmers. Average gross margin per hectare was US$1,215.37. Average GRR and NRR per hectare were estimated at 1.14 and 0.94 respectively.
